HALF BRED [1 record]

Record 1 2005-12-15

English

Subject field(s)
  • Horse Husbandry
  • Horse Racing and Equestrian Sports
DEF

A horse with only one parent being considered [...] purebred.

CONT

An other classification [of horses] differentiates "warm-blooded" horses, those with either arab or thoroughbred or both in their ancestry, from "cold-blooded" breeds ... which lack this heritage.

OBS

The hyphenated form, "a half-bred", is preferable.

OBS

Also applies to a thoroughbred horse that is not eligible for entry in the "General Stud Book".
